Spearfishing For Beginners

Monday 22 March 2010 @ 3:03 pm

Spearfishing is a form of hunting used by divers to catch fish all over the world. The hunter has the ability to choose which fish he/she would like to take without harming other marine life.

Bass Fishing With Subsurface Plugs

Monday 22 March 2010 @ 3:03 pm

On the market today there exist numerous lures in the category of subsurface plugs. These lures are hard-bodied baits that run from a few feet to as much as thirty feet beneath the surface.
